Beschreibung

This book is a product of personal and collective trauma, and a reflection of the ongoing Russo-Ukrainian War. It compiles narratives, shared by Olga Khomenko¿s family members, friends, and former students, over the first two years of Russia¿s full-scale invasion of Ukraine. The impetus for this endeavor was an interview of the author for Japanese media in early 2022, which revealed a significant knowledge gap about Ukrainian history and culture. Driven by a deep sense of responsibility, Khomenko wrote this book to amplify the voice of Ukrainians and their experiences in this war.

Autorenportrait

Dr Olga Khomenko is a CARA/British Academy Fellow at the Nissan Institute of Japanese Studies at the University of Oxford, specializing in Japanese Studies and International History, with a particular focus on Eastern Asia and Eastern Europe. She studied in Kyiv and Tokyo and taught at the Kyiv-Mohyla Academy, Kyiv School of Economics as well as at Kyiv-Mohyla Business School. She also worked at the Ukrainian Embassy in Tokyo and reported at the Ukrainian News agency UNIAN in Kyiv and BBC News Ukrainian in Tokyo. Khomenko was a Fulbright Scholar at the Harvard Ukrainian Research Institute and held fellowships of Japan¿s Ministry of Education, Culture, Sport, Science and Technology (MEXT) and the Japan Society for the Promotion of Science (JSPS). She is author of Ukrainians beyond Borders (Gunzosha 2022), The Far Eastern Odyssey of Ivan Svit (Laurus 2021), From Ukraine with Love (Gunzosha 2014), and co-translator into Japanese of A Short Anthology of Contemporary Ukrainian Literature (Gunzosha 2005).

Dr Hiroaki Kuromiya is Emeritus Professor of History at Indiana University in Bloomington.
